The India Reality: Sovereign Compute and the GPU Surge
In India, the shift to AI Factories is being subsidized by aggressive state intervention. The IndiaAI Mission has evolved from a policy framework into a massive infrastructure play. As of early 2026, India has operationalized over 38,000 GPUs, with another 20,000 slated for the national compute portal.
For the Indian founder, the strategic advantage has moved from “building a wrapper” to “owning the weights.” MeitY’s IndiaAI Mission 2.0 is specifically targeting verticalized models for healthcare, logistics, and the India Stack 2.0. Enterprises like Tata and Reliance are no longer just consumers; they are builders of Sovereign AI, treating data centers as the new steel plants of the digital economy. The goal is simple: eliminate the token tax paid to Silicon Valley by running specialized, quantized models on domestic hardware.
The Pivot: From LLM to Agentic Orchestration
The AI Factory is not just a collection of models; it is a pipeline of autonomous agents. In 2026, the value has migrated from the generation of text to the execution of workflows.
- Unit Economics: Fine-tuned Small Language Models (SLMs) such as Phi-4 or Llama-4-Vertical are now 10x to 100x cheaper to run than frontier APIs while maintaining higher accuracy on domain-specific tasks.
- Latency as a Competitive Moat: By running inference on-premise or at the private edge, enterprises are achieving sub-100ms response times, enabling real-time automated decisioning that was impossible via external cloud APIs.
- Data Provenance: The AI Factory allows for “Secure Memory” architectures, where proprietary data never leaves the corporate firewall, satisfying the increasingly rigid global regulatory environment.
## CXO Stakes: Capital Allocation and Systemic Risk
For the C-Suite, the “ROI Reckoning” is a governance mandate. The risks of remaining on a generalist trajectory are now existential.
1. The OPEX Trap: Relying on third-party APIs for core business logic creates a “Variable Cost Monster.” As usage scales, token bills can consume the very efficiency gains the AI was meant to provide.
2. Model Fragility: Generalist models are subject to “silent updates” from providers, which can break fragile enterprise prompts. An internal AI Factory provides version control and deterministic outcomes.
3. The Commoditization of Intelligence: If you use the same model as your competitor, you have no moat. The only sustainable advantage in 2026 is the Proprietary Feedback Loop—training your internal factory on data your competitors cannot access.
